"Batman: Revolution Unveils Burton-Verse's Riddler in 1989 Sequel"
Tim Burton's iconic Batman universe is expanding yet again, this time through a captivating new novel titled *Batman: Revolution*. Penned by acclaimed author John Jackson Miller and brought to readers by Penguin Random House, this thrilling addition introduces fans to the Burton-Verse's unique take on The Riddler. The novel is already available for preorder on Amazon, promising an exciting journey into Gotham's shadowy depths.
As reported by ComicBook.com, *Batman: Revolution* serves as a sequel to 2024's *Batman: Resurrection*, also written by Miller. Both novels are set between the events of the 1989 *Batman* film and 1992's *Batman Returns*, drawing inspiration from Burton's unproduced third Batman movie, which was rumored to feature Robin Williams as The Riddler.

Here's the official synopsis for *Batman: Revolution*:
*It’s summer, and Gotham City has cause for celebration. The last vestiges of The Joker’s toxic legacy have finally faded, just in time for the mayor to partner with retail magnate Max Shreck to stage a Fourth of July celebration for the ages. But not everyone is rejoicing. Batman’s eternal vigilance continues as threats from rival gangs and masked criminals escalate by the day. Meanwhile, on the streets, protests grow in opposition to the city’s lavish excesses.*
*No one is experiencing the struggle between Gotham’s optimism and doubt more than Norman Pinkus. The Gotham Globe’s humble copy boy, he’s the unacknowledged mastermind behind the newspaper’s mega-popular Riddle Me This word puzzles. But Norman harbors a secret. He is the smartest man in Gotham City, using his prodigious skills to solve crimes anonymously for years via the police tip line—before Batman even knows there’s a crime to solve.*
*While neither fame nor fortune finds Norman, he believes in the promise of Gotham and what’s right . . . until he doesn’t. The man no one notices watches time and again as the city and its leaders cast their eyes high above the rooftops toward Batman. Dejected and unappreciated, Norman devises a scheme: With the help of dangerous new friends, he exploits the simmering tensions of the long hot summer to draw the Caped Crusader into a volatile game of riddles to crown Gotham’s true savior. As they clash, Norman—now known as The Riddler—and Batman will uncover hidden secrets about Gotham’s past that will have dire consequences for the city’s future.*
*Batman: Revolution* is set to hit the shelves on October 28, 2025, and can be preordered on Amazon.

Not to be outdone, DC Comics continues to enrich the Burton-Verse. Following the release of *Batman '89*, which served as a sequel to *Batman Returns* and introduced a Billy Dee Williams-inspired Two-Face and a Marlon Wayans-inspired Robin, DC published *Batman '89: Echoes*. This comic further expands the universe with characters inspired by Jeff Goldblum as Scarecrow and Madonna as Harley Quinn. Additionally, DC has released two volumes of *Superman '78*, which continue the legacy of the Christopher Reeve Superman films.
